Costa Rica, for the first time. 🇨🇷

High in the mountains of Tarrazú, our new limited-edition Single Origin is grown and harvested around Santa María de Dota, and sourced through local coffee cooperative Coope Dota.

Bright and beautifully balanced, with notes of roasted pineapple, pear and almond.

The Nero New Writers Prize is back.

Designed to discover and support the next generation of writing talent, the prize is open to aspiring, unpublished writers across the UK and Ireland.

The winner will receive £3,000, a fully funded MA in Creative Writing at Brunel University of London, and an introduction to a literary agent.

Entries must be an original, unpublished short story of up to 5,000 words, in fiction or narrative non-fiction.

Entries close 11 September 2026.

The Coffee Shop is located at House Inn2 Carshalton Road in Sutton. For those who prefer public transport, there are several bus stops nearby, including the Sutton Bus Garage and Benhill Avenue. The nearest train station is Sutton Station, which is approximately a 15-minute walk away. For those driving, there is limited parking available around the area and a paid car park nearby on Throwley Way.
